Police Seek Pizza Shop Armed Robber With Distinctive "God" Tattoo:Β The St. Clair ShoresΒ cashier opened the register, turned to tell a manager that the pizzaΒ order was up, and turned back to find aΒ gun pointed at her face.
Police Arrest Northville Woman Found Taking Mom's Pills:Β A woman told police that she thought her daughter, who she saidΒ has a drug problem,Β picked up her VicodinΒ prescription without her permission from CVS Pharmacy
Utica Police: Man Seen Stealing 'Grand Theft Auto' Video Games:Β A 52-year-old man from Flint was held by Utica Police after witnesses said he took three copies of a video gameΒ from Best Buy.
VIDEO: Man Arrested on Multiple Charges After Fleeing From Police:Β Police use tire deflation devices to stop the vehicle.
West Bloomfield Teacher Faces New Criminal Sex Conduct Charge:Β Based on testimony from his formerΒ student, aΒ West Bloomfield High teacherΒ faces a new charge of fourth-degree criminal sexual conduct.
